infopop simply leads people astray, does not give clear warnings and instructions, allows more and more people to screw up their databases, their boards, and to lose hours and hours of time!!!

I never had a warning. The altertable php has no warnings that this might time out and thus corrupt the database. No explanation what to do in case of a timeout.

Simply, in my case, the upgrade cannot be done the way they say it. When I ran the altertable php from the telnet command line, one part took almost 2 hours. There is no web routine that reliably does such a chore without timeout. Just not possible.


A well documented software gives clear warnings. Maybe prints a time estimate for the duration of the data base manipulation before starting the routine.

They could easily just give a altertable file with mysql database commands, instead of web based commands for dummies. Maybe upgrade in batches of 10 000.

Infopop people try to make things easy, and this way they REALLY make it complicated!!!! Clicking away happily at routines that are DOOMED to fail is not good. Looks easy until the corruption surfaces.
